Mengonversi Templat Gambar Visio Macro-Enabled (.vstm) ke Dokumen Sumber LaTeX (.tex) Menggunakan GroupDocs.Conversion untuk .NET

Perkenalan

Apakah Anda kesulitan mengonversi Template Gambar Visio Macro-Enabled (VSTM) ke dalam dokumen LaTeX? Mengonversi file VSTM yang rumit ke dalam format TEX dapat menjadi tugas yang berat tanpa alat yang tepat. Masukkan GroupDocs.Konversi untuk .NET, pustaka efisien yang dirancang untuk memperlancar proses konversi ini dengan mulus.

Dalam tutorial ini, kami akan memandu Anda menggunakan GroupDocs.Conversion for .NET untuk mengonversi VSTM ke dokumen sumber LaTeX (.tex). Dengan mengikuti langkah-langkah ini, Anda akan memperoleh kemampuan untuk mengotomatiskan dan menyederhanakan alur kerja konversi dokumen Anda.

Apa yang Akan Anda Pelajari:

  • Cara mengatur GroupDocs.Conversion untuk .NET
  • Proses mengkonversi file VSTM ke format TEX
  • Aplikasi praktis fitur ini dalam skenario dunia nyata

Dengan pengantar itu, mari kita bahas prasyarat yang Anda perlukan sebelum kita mulai.

Prasyarat

Sebelum memulai proses konversi, pastikan Anda memiliki hal berikut:

Pustaka dan Dependensi yang Diperlukan:

  • GroupDocs.Konversi untuk .NET: Ini adalah pustaka utama yang memfasilitasi konversi dokumen. Kami akan menggunakan versi 25.3.0.

Persyaratan Pengaturan Lingkungan:

  • Lingkungan pengembangan yang mampu menjalankan aplikasi .NET (misalnya, Visual Studio).

Prasyarat Pengetahuan:

  • Pemahaman dasar tentang pemrograman C#.
  • Kemampuan dalam menangani jalur file dan direktori dalam aplikasi .NET.

Setelah prasyarat ini terpenuhi, mari beralih ke pengaturan GroupDocs.Conversion untuk proyek .NET Anda.

Menyiapkan GroupDocs.Conversion untuk .NET

Untuk mulai mengonversi file VSTM ke dokumen LaTeX, pertama-tama Anda perlu menginstal pustaka GroupDocs.Conversion. Berikut caranya:

Konsol Pengelola Paket NuGet

Anda dapat dengan mudah menambahkan paket menggunakan perintah berikut di Konsol Pengelola Paket NuGet:

Install-Package GroupDocs.Conversion -Version 25.3.0

.KLIK NET

Atau, jika Anda lebih suka menggunakan Antarmuka Baris Perintah (CLI) .NET, gunakan perintah ini:

dotnet add package GroupDocs.Conversion --version 25.3.0

Langkah-langkah Memperoleh Lisensi

Inisialisasi dan Pengaturan Dasar dengan C#

Setelah terinstal, Anda dapat menginisialisasi GroupDocs.Conversion sebagai berikut:

using System;
using GroupDocs.Conversion;

// Buat contoh kelas Converter untuk memuat berkas VSTM Anda.
using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Y\\\\sample.vstm"))
{
    // Kode konversi Anda akan ditempatkan di sini.
}

Sekarang setelah Anda menyiapkan perpustakaan, mari beralih ke penerapan fitur konversi.

Panduan Implementasi

Ringkasan

Bagian ini menyediakan panduan langkah demi langkah tentang cara mengonversi file VSTM ke format TEX menggunakan GroupDocs.Conversion for .NET. Kami akan menguraikan setiap bagian dari proses tersebut untuk memastikan kejelasan dan kemudahan pemahaman.

Langkah 1: Tentukan Jalur Input dan Output

Pertama, tentukan jalur untuk file VSTM masukan Anda dan direktori keluaran tempat file TEX yang dikonversi akan disimpan.

string documentPath = "YOUR_DOCUMENT_DIRECTORY\\\\sample.vstm"; // Ganti dengan jalur file Anda yang sebenarnya
string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putFolder, "vstm-converted-to.tex");

Langkah 2: Konfigurasikan Opsi Konversi

Siapkan opsi konversi untuk menentukan format target sebagai TEX.

using GroupDocs.Conversion.Options.Convert;

var options = new PageDescriptionLanguageConvertOptions 
{
    Format = GroupDocs.Conversion.FileTypes.PageDescriptionLanguageFileType.Tex
};

Itu PageDescriptionLanguageConvertOptions kelas memungkinkan Anda mengonfigurasi pengaturan khusus untuk mengonversi bahasa deskripsi halaman seperti LaTeX.

Langkah 3: Lakukan Konversi

Terakhir, jalankan konversi dan simpan file keluaran di lokasi yang ditentukan.

using (var converter = new Converter(documentPath))
{
    converter.Convert(outputFile, options);
}

Potongan kode ini memuat berkas VSTM Anda, menerapkan pengaturan konversi, dan menulis dokumen TEX yang dihasilkan ke disk.

Tips Pemecahan Masalah

  • Kesalahan Jalur Tidak ValidPastikan jalur masukan dan keluaran Anda benar.
  • Masalah Izin: Periksa apakah Anda memiliki izin menulis untuk direktori keluaran.

Aplikasi Praktis

Kemampuan untuk mengonversi file VSTM menjadi dokumen LaTeX dapat diaplikasikan dalam berbagai skenario dunia nyata, seperti:

  1. Penerbitan Akademik: Peneliti mengonversi diagram dari Visio ke format LaTeX untuk makalah ilmiah.
  2. Dokumentasi Teknis: Organisasi yang mengotomatiskan konversi gambar teknis dan templat.
  3. Pengembangan Perangkat Lunak: Pengembang yang mengintegrasikan konversi dokumen dalam aplikasi .NET.

Selain itu, GroupDocs.Conversion dapat diintegrasikan dengan sistem dan kerangka kerja .NET lainnya untuk meningkatkan fungsionalitas di berbagai proyek.

Pertimbangan Kinerja

Saat bekerja dengan file VSTM besar atau melakukan konversi batch, pertimbangkan kiat berikut untuk mengoptimalkan kinerja:

  • Manajemen Sumber Daya: Memantau penggunaan memori selama proses konversi.
  • Pemrosesan Batch: Mengonversi dokumen secara batch untuk mengelola sumber daya sistem secara efisien.
  • Praktik TerbaikIkuti praktik terbaik manajemen memori .NET saat menggunakan GroupDocs.Conversion untuk mencegah kebocoran dan memastikan operasi yang lancar.

Kesimpulan

Dengan mengikuti tutorial ini, Anda kini memiliki alat dan pengetahuan untuk mengonversi file VSTM menjadi dokumen LaTeX menggunakan GroupDocs.Conversion for .NET. Kemampuan ini dapat secara signifikan menyederhanakan alur kerja penanganan dokumen Anda dalam berbagai pengaturan profesional.

Sebagai langkah selanjutnya, pertimbangkan untuk menjelajahi fitur tambahan GroupDocs.Conversion atau mengintegrasikannya dengan sistem lain dalam proyek Anda. Kami menganjurkan Anda untuk mencoba menerapkan solusi ini dalam aplikasi Anda sendiri dan melihat manfaatnya secara langsung.

Bagian FAQ

  1. Bisakah saya mengonversi beberapa file VSTM sekaligus?
    • Ya, Anda dapat mengotomatiskan pemrosesan batch dengan mengulangi kumpulan file VSTM dan menerapkan logika konversi ke masing-masing file.
  2. Format file apa yang didukung GroupDocs.Conversion selain TEX?
    • Mendukung berbagai format dokumen termasuk PDF, Word, Excel, dan banyak lagi.
  3. Bagaimana cara menangani kesalahan selama konversi?
    • Terapkan penanganan kesalahan menggunakan blok try-catch untuk mengelola pengecualian secara efektif.
  4. Apakah ada biaya kinerja yang terkait dengan mengonversi file besar?
    • Meskipun file yang lebih besar mungkin memerlukan lebih banyak sumber daya, mengoptimalkan aplikasi Anda dapat mengurangi potensi pelambatan.
  5. Bisakah solusi ini diintegrasikan ke aplikasi cloud?
    • Ya, GroupDocs.Conversion untuk .NET cocok untuk aplikasi lokal dan berbasis cloud.

Sumber daya

Untuk bacaan lebih lanjut dan dukungan:

Dengan panduan lengkap ini, Anda akan siap untuk mulai mengonversi file VSTM menjadi dokumen TEX menggunakan GroupDocs.Conversion for .NET. Selamat membuat kode!